😻 How do I apply for a CFA cattery name?

A cattery name, including punctuation and blanks, may not exceed 12 spaces. An official CFA cattery name application form is required to apply. The form may be submitted online, or via PDF.

😻 Why is it so hard to choose a cattery name?

Payment of the fee in effect for a cattery The choosing and registering of a cattery name with the Cat Fanciers’ Association has sometimes proven to be rather challenging simply because of the large number of names, and similar names, that are already registered.

😻 How much does it cost to register a cattery name?

Once the permanent cattery name request is requested and accomplished no further renewal fees will be required. If a new person wants to establish a cattery name and opts for a lifetime permanent name with CFA the charge would be $75 for the initial process and $100 for the lifetime registration fee for that name.

    How many names should I list in the cattery name application?
    The Cattery Name Application requires that four names be listed in the order of preference. When you submit the cattery name application, do NOT list a name that you do not want. Note: CFA will not “reserve” a cattery name pending receipt of an application.
    How do I choose a cattery name?
    An alphabetical list will be presented containing existing registered cattery names that begin with the letter you selected. There is also an option to preview registered cattery names that begin with numbers (“#”). When choosing a cattery name, first check the rules governing the acceptability of a cattery name.

    What are the requirements for a cattery name?
    A newly registered cattery name must be at least a minimum of two letters different from any existing registered cattery name. Double letters (tt, ee, ss, etc.) count as one letter. The use or non-use of an “s” indicating plural at the end of a word does not constitute a letter difference. List your choices for your cattery name.
    How long does it take to process a cattery name application?
    NOTE: Processing of a cattery name application will take approximately 14-21 business days. NOTE: The 3 boxes below, showing that you have read and understand the cattery name application process, MUST be checked in order for your cattery name application to be handled by Central Office.
    What is the character limit for a cattery name?
    NOTE: Cattery names may not exceed twelve (12) characters, including dashes, hyphens, blanks, etc. A newly registered cattery name must be at least a minimum of two letters different from any existing registered cattery name.
    What are the requirements for a new cattery name?
    A newly registered cattery name must be at least a minimum of two letters different from any existing registered cattery name. Double letters (tt, ee, ss, etc.) count as one letter.

    How do I apply for a cattery name?
    A cattery name, including punctuation and blanks, may not exceed 12 spaces. An official CFA cattery name application form is required to apply. The form may be submitted online, or via PDF. A given name – Marie, John, Frank, Helen for example – cannot be used. Titles, such as Princess, Earl, or Madam may not be used.
    What is the cost of a cattery name?
    The purpose of a cattery name is to identify the breeder and/or owner of a cat or kitten and to identify the line of breeding. A new cattery name will be registered for an initial five (5) year period. The fee is $75.00. You must read the following prior to placing your order for a cattery name:
